.contactform_contact_form__ltQNb{width:50%;margin:0 auto;padding:20px;background-color:#f0f8ff}.contactform_contact_form__ltQNb h2{font-size:2.5rem;text-align:center;margin-bottom:20px;color:#b2363d}.contactform_contact_form__ltQNb .contactform_form_container__AZE13{display:flex}.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n{width:50%;margin-bottom:20px}.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n label{color:#000;display:block;margin-bottom:5px}.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n input[type=email],.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n input[type=number],.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n input[type=text],.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n textarea{width:100%;padding:10px;border:1px solid #ccc;border-radius:5px;font-size:1rem}.contactform_contact_form__ltQNb button[type=submit]{width:100%;padding:10px;background-color:#007bff;color:#fff;border:none;border-radius:5px;font-size:1rem;cursor:pointer;transition:all .3s ease-in-out}.contactform_contact_form__ltQNb button[type=submit]:hover{background-color:#0062cc}@media screen and (max-width:768px){.contactform_contact_form__ltQNb{width:100%}.contactform_contact_form__ltQNb .contactform_form_container__AZE13{flex-wrap:nowrap}.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n{width:50%;margin-bottom:0}.contactform_contact_form__ltQNb .contactform_form_container__AZE13 .contactform_form_group__e3Vvn:last-of-type{margin-right:0}}.contactshowcase_container__nqhFl{background-color:#e6f0ff;width:50%;padding:20px;margin:0 auto;color:#2f4f4f}.contactshowcase_container__nqhFl h2{font-size:2.5rem;text-align:center;margin-bottom:50px;color:#b2363d}.contactshowcase_container__nqhFl .contactshowcase_contact_details__adcrq{display:flex;flex-direction:column;place-content:center;place-items:center;font-size:calc(8px + 1vw);margin-bottom:30px}.contactshowcase_container__nqhFl .contactshowcase_contact_details__adcrq a{background-color:#2f4f4f;color:#fff;padding:10px;border-radius:5px}.contactshowcase_container__nqhFl .contactshowcase_contact_details__adcrq a:hover{background-color:#b2363d}@media screen and (max-width:768px){.contactshowcase_container__nqhFl{width:100%}}.socialmedia_social_icons_container__PK5mg{display:flex;align-items:center}.socialmedia_social_icons_container__PK5mg a{margin-right:10px;transition:all .3s ease-in-out}.socialmedia_social_icons_container__PK5mg a:last-child{margin-right:0}.socialmedia_social_icons_container__PK5mg a svg{width:44px;height:44px;fill:#333}.socialmedia_social_icons_container__PK5mg a:hover svg{fill:#007bff}.contact_container__hO_U1{display:flex;min-height:80vh}@media screen and (max-width:768px){.contact_container__hO_U1{display:grid}}